Well, in the current version of the code you will want to use 
SecureXmlRpcClient instead of XmlRpcClient.  I am working on some 
changes to XmlRpcClient that will make it work the way the original 
poster mentioned, just using https in the URL.

Watch for this in a future version of HttpClient.
